Output 1666324c81d72ea20a0f5154956c5cab799da5f50490ecfde0147b89d38a4cde:1

value
103019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ff406296a0fa16d1ac9f1765999e1f511e95aa1 OP_EQUAL
address
3BtyFvh4HUmHYe17N3W7kWeXTfMqRfCE2w
transaction
1666324c81d72ea20a0f5154956c5cab799da5f50490ecfde0147b89d38a4cde
spent
true